WHAT IS DESILLUSIONISM?

\\n

Mookie Tenembaum is the founder of the Desillusionism think-tank, a philosophy that states:

\\n

Reality as we experience it is a teleological narrative, i.e. goal-directed, in which material and illusory parts are confused.

\\n

This narrative facilitates and allows the individual to interact out of inertia, in synchrony and in tune with \\u201cthe other\\u201d and \\u201cthe others\\u201d.

\\n

This interaction occurs, in turn, escaping from and dealing with an endless string of sufferings and trying to handle them, with the threat of our own terrifying death always on the horizon.
